<ItemTemplate> <asp:CheckBox ID="idcheckbox" runat="server" OnCheckedChanged="idcheckbox_CheckedChanged" AutoPostBack="True" /> </ItemTemplate> protected void idcheckbox_CheckedChanged(object sender, EventArgs e) ...{ CheckBox c = sender as CheckBox; GridViewRow row = c.NamingContainer as GridViewRow; row.BackColor = c.Checked ? System.Drawing.Color.Red : System.Drawing.Color.White; }